READINGS IN RESPONSIVE ART, DESIGN, AND THEORY:
- New Media Art, edited by Mark Tribe and Reena Jana, Taschen, 2006
- The Interventionists: Users' Manual for the Creative Disruption of Everyday Life by Nato Thompson (Editor), Gregory Sholette (Editor), MIT Press, 2006
- The New Media Reader, Noah Wardrip-Fruin, MIT Press, 2003
- Christiane Paul, Digital Art, Thames and Hudson, NY 2003
- New Media in Late 20th Century Art, by Michael Rush, Thames & Hudson, 1999
- Terrence Masson, CG 101, New Riders Publishing, 1999
- The Digital Dialectic, Peter Lunenfeld, MIT Press, 2001
- Art @ Science, edited by Christa Sommerer and Laurent Mignonneau, SpringerWien, 1998
- Strange and Charmed: Science and the Contemporary Visual Arts, edited by Sian Ede, Calouste Gulbenkian Foundation, 2000
- Daniels, Dieter: Strategies of Interactivity. In: Rudolf Frieling & Dieter Daniels (eds.). Medien Kunst Interaktion. Wien: Springer. 2000
- Weibel, Peter: “The World as Interface: Toward the Construction of
Context-Controlled Event-Worlds”, in Electronic Culture. Edited by Timothy
Druckrey. New York: Aperture, 1996
- Huhtamo, Erkki: “Commentaries on Metacommentaries on Interactivity”, in CAD
Forum, 4th International Conference on Development and Use of
ComputerSystems, MediaScape, Zagreb
- Dinkla, Söke: “The History of the Interface in Interactive Art”. Available
online at http://www.kenfeingold.com/dinkla_history.html (link last checked
Jan. 9, 2007).
- Stocker, Gerfried and Schoepf, Christine: Code: The Language of Our Time,
Ars Electronica 2003. Ostfildern-Ruit: Hatje Cantz, 2003.
- The Virtual Dimension, edited by John Backman, Princton Architectural Press, 1998
- The Age of Spiritual Machines: When Computers Exceed Human Intelligence, Ray Kurzweil, Penguin Books, 1999
- The Cyborg Handbook by Chris Hables Gray, Routledge, 1996
- How We Became Posthuman : Virtual Bodies in Cybernetics, Literature, and Informatics, N. Katherine Hayles,, University Of Chicago Press, 1999
- Metal and Flesh, The Evolution of Man: Technology Takes Over , Ollivier Dyens, MIT Press, 2001
GUIDEBOOKS ON PHYSICAL COMPUTING, BASIC ELECTRONICS, AND MECHATRONICS
- Physical Computing: Sensing and Controlling the Physical World with Computers, Tom Igoe and Dan O'Sullivan.
- Getting Started in Electronics, Forrest M. Mimms III
- Electronic Sensor Circuits and Projects, Mimms, Radio Shack Engineer's Mini Notebook Series
- The Microcontroller Application Cookbook (1 + 2), by Matt Gilliland, Parallax, Inc., 2002
- Programming and Customizing the Basic Stamp Computer, by Scott Edwards, McGraw-Hill, 1998
- The Robot Builder's Bonanza, by Gordon McComb, McGraw-Hill, 2001
- Cabaret Mechanical Movement, by Aidan Lawrence Onn, Gary Alexander, Cabaret Mechanical Publishing, 1998
